So it's no surprise that Seiko regularly delves into its own archives to inspire its new models. They use a variety of terms. Sometimes it's a reissue, and other times it's more of a reinterpretation. The Seiko Recraft Series is Seiko’s modern line of affordable watches with vintage styling. The watches aren’t reissues of any specific past models. Instead, they have a vintage-inspired design language, making them reminiscent of watches from previous generations. And not just any watches. The Seiko Recraft series offers a unique, even quirky look that sets them apart from most watches available today. Particularly watches from mass-market brands.
